Method 1: How To Uninstall WhatsApp On Mac Manually
Sadly, after deleting an app’s executable file its service files continue to stay on your Mac. Therefore, dragging and dropping WhatsApp desktop into the “Trash” to remove it completely is not an option. All of the files related to the WhatsApp service must also be deleted to execute a clean removal of the app. To do so manually follow the below steps:
- Close the WhatsApp app, if it is running in the background.
- Go to the “Applications” folder and choose “Move to Trash” from the Context menu.

- Select “Go” from the menu bar after clicking the “Finder icon” from the Dock.
- Choose “Go to Folder.”
- Copy & paste these file locations listed below into the text box one by one time, then select the folders.
~/Library/Application Support/WhatsApp/
~/Library/Caches/WhatsApp/
~/Library/Saved Application State/WhatsApp.savedState/
~/Library/Preferences/WhatsApp.plist/
~/Library/Preferences/WhatsApp.Helper.plist/
~/Library/Logs/WhatsApp/
- Drag those files to the “Trash” when you discover them.
- Clear the “Trash.”
